Ceramic tile production is a very complex process. The production process is an assembly of chemical, mechanical, thermo-dynamical and other processes which must be finely tuned for good and successful production. In the production chain there are numerous ways for things to go wrong. Every failure directly reflects on the final ceramic tile. The final production phase is visual inspection, classification and packing of ceramic tiles. In most cases the last phase is based on human perception capability. Human resources as controllers in this phase are very unreliable. During hard working conditions in plant and human visual perception limitations, a man as a controller chain could be a source of failures and decrease production yield and product quality which increases total production costs. To avoid or minimize human related failure causes as much as possible, This book presents one of the ways how to introduce automatics as the main worker for this stage in the ceramic tile production
